Essential Functions:
· Crew Management (35%) – ?The Construction Manager directs work crews of three or four field technicians that will be installing, erecting, maintaining, repairing, removing, or retrofit towers and rooftop antenna systems.
· Scheduling (20%) - ?The Construction Manager will work directly with the Construction Project Manager or customer to establish schedule priorities and to resolve projected schedule conflicts. He/she is responsible for the co-creation of daily/weekly work schedules for the SureSite teams. Construction Manager is responsible for ensuring that adequate levels of sites, resources and equipment are available to support the work schedule.
· Documentation (10%) -? Construction Manager will ensure that all installation, test and inspection results are logged to the appropriate section of the “Site Folder” and that all required supporting documentation necessary to achieve invoicing is complete and available. He/she will ensure that reports, correspondence and technical records are promptly and accurately archived and distributed.
· Quality (10%) -? The Construction Manager, in cooperation with the Construction Field Technician III / Foreman, is responsible for the delivery of defect-free services to the customer. He/she will work diligently to see that quality is built into the product and that competence lapses receive immediate attention and are promptly and permanently rectified.
· Reporting (10%) –? The Construction Manager is responsible for monitoring construction progress, reporting performance against the schedule and for identifying obstacles to performance. Reporting is done daily and addresses a full range of issues including inventory, logistics, site readiness, facilities available, support resources and quality. However, the exact reporting schedule and contents are to be agreed prior to the commencement of construction activities.
· Pre-Construction Walks (15%) -? The Construction Manager is responsible for doing pre-construction walks as directed by the Construction Project Manager. The Construction Manager will be responsible for understanding the scope of work for the assigned project. The Construction Manager will be responsible for collecting materials needed, technician hours estimate for assigned project after the pre-con walk. The Construction Manager will be jointly responsible for creating quotes for the projects assigned.
· Other -? The Construction Manager will be responsible for assisting the Construction Project Manager in the installation of all network elements installed on site and other equipment as applicable and directed by the National Director of Construction.
Requirements
Requirements:
· At least 10 years of industry experience including at least five years in a leadership role (CM or Foreman).
· Job related certifications – safety, rescue, CPR, etc.
· At least a High School Diploma/GED.
· Anritsu / PIM / fiber testing certification.
· Connector certification (Andrew, PPC, CommScope, etc.).
· Previous experience working as a tower climber and man lifts.
· Previous experience working as a field technician or foreman.
· Computer skills and knowledge of SWEEP and PIM equipment.
· Ability to know basic architecture of 4G, 5G, C-Band.
· Knowledge of Macro builds.
· Ability to understand RF Design for cell sites. RFDS knowledge.
· Must have full knowledge of RF and grounding safety standard installation.
· Good written and spoken communication skills.
· Must understand basic concepts of business margins.
· Ability to perform pre-construction walks and provide estimates for requested work.
· Understanding of close out documentation.
· Ability to read zoning/construction drawings.
· Experience using Microsoft 365 – specifically Word, Excel and Teams.
